Hi everyone. I'm in the process of obtaining renters insurance.
The two companies that I'm currently looking at are Avemco and
AOPA for insurance.

I was wondering if anyone has any positive or negative comments
or recommendations about either of the two fore mentioned companies.
Please let me know if there is another company I should be looking
at.

Avemco is an insurance company. AOPA is an insurance *agency*.

I've had good service from AOPAIA the past two years; my rates were less
then Avemco by several hundred dollars per year (172, no IFR). AOPAIA
placed me with USAIG. The other major company they deal with is AIG. Don't
know if there are others; might depend upon the type of a/c, your
utilization, etc.
